Indra and Synaptic Aviation Revolutionize Airport Operations with AI in Spain

Revolutionizing Airport Management with Artificial Intelligence



As airports around the world strive for greater efficiency and sustainability, the innovative collaboration between Indra and Synaptic Aviation is reshaping operations in Spain. The deployment of advanced artificial intelligence technology at three major airports—Adolfo Suárez Madrid-Barajas, Josep Tarradellas Barcelona-El Prat, and Palma de Mallorca—is set to transform ground operations significantly.

Enhancing Ground Operations



Aimed primarily at streamlining operations such as passenger boarding and aircraft turnaround, this advanced digital system integrates AI to monitor various activities involved in aircraft servicing. Each year, these three airports, under Aena's management, accommodate over 150 million passengers and manage approximately 477 aircraft parking positions, making the need for enhanced operational efficiency crucial.

The system leverages real-time video feeds from strategically placed cameras to track aircraft movements and essential apron activities, including but not limited to GPU connection, fueling, and catering services. By automating the monitoring process, significant events can be captured and analyzed instantly, leading to improved operational predictability.

Through the adoption of AI, the solution enhances real-time visibility, enabling all airport stakeholders to make quicker, more informed decisions. This rapid access to precise data assists in minimizing delays, reducing emissions, and improving cost efficiency for airlines and airport operators alike.

A Secure, Tailored Approach



Security is paramount when integrating such advanced technologies into airport infrastructure. The joint solution from Indra and Synaptic Aviation has been custom-tailored to align with each airport's cybersecurity policies, ensuring a secure deployment. This localized application promises immediate operational benefits, allowing airport teams to leverage reliable information and make quicker decisions without requiring substantial changes to existing setups.
